Fire When Ready!

Paul reminds us that there are spiritual gifts and that love is one of them. "Make love your aim" he said in I Cor. 14:1, "and earnestly desire the Spiritual gifts..."

How can we strive for love, when it is a gift? Can we set out on a day's journey to find it? Can we plan a program of activity whereby we can earn love? Is it a reward for good living?

If love is given, then perhaps some people are blessed with it, and others never receive it! If love is a gift...then will some divine Santa Claus bestow it upon me some day? How uninteresting!

Is not love a part of creation? We were made with it in side! Everyone has it...but many deny it! Some reject it...act as though it weren't so!

But for the person who aims his life at Christ, seeks to know the fullness of Christian grace and forgiveness, then love blossoms forth like the plum tree in Spring, like the ears of corn in Summer, and like the pears in the Fall.

"Make love your aim", Paul said. I say: "Good hunting! Take careful aim. Fire, when ready!"
